Thomas Paine Award
Thomas Paine, the author of Common Sense, lived in the nascent United States as an American, and abroad as an expatriate, and in both places demonstrated the extraordinary power of the pen in stoking revolutionary fires to promote greater freedom and a more equal sharing of human rights by all mankind.
Purpose: To acknowledge common sense, creativity and boldness in the journalistic coverage of overseas Americans
Frequency: Occasional
Nominations: Nominations are welcomed. Winner is determined by American Citizens Abroad.
